Common name | Boc-Pro-Aib-D-Leu-Aib-D-Val-OMe |
---|---|
Chemical name | t-Butyloxycarbonyl-prolyl-alpha-aminoisobutyryl -D-leucyl-alpha-aminoisobutyryl-D-valyl-methyl ester |
Formula | C30 H53 N5 O8 |
Calculated formula | C30 H53 N5 O8 |
SMILES | C(C)(C)(C)OC(=O)N1[C@H](C(=O)NC(C(=O)N[C@@H](C(=O)NC(C(=O)N[C@@H](C(=O)OC)C(C)C)(C)C)CC(C)C)(C)C)CCC1 |
Title of publication | Hydrophobic Peptide Channels and Encapsulated Water Wires |
Authors of publication | Upadhyayula S. Raghavender; Kantharaju; Subrayashastry Aravinda; Narayanaswamy Shamala; Padmanabhan Balaram |
Journal of publication | Journal of the American Chemical Society |
Year of publication | 2010 |
Journal volume | 132 |
Pages of publication | 1075 - 1086 |
a | 24.4102 ± 0.0008 Å |
b | 24.4102 ± 0.0008 Å |
c | 10.6627 ± 0.0007 Å |
α | 90° |
β | 90° |
γ | 120° |
Cell volume | 5502.3 ± 0.4 Å3 |
Cell temperature | 293 ± 2 K |
Ambient diffraction temperature | 293 ± 2 K |
Number of distinct elements | 4 |
Space group number | 169 |
Hermann-Mauguin space group symbol | P 61 |
Hall space group symbol | P 61 |
Residual factor for all reflections | 0.0668 |
Residual factor for significantly intense reflections | 0.0543 |
Weighted residual factors for significantly intense reflections | 0.1495 |
Weighted residual factors for all reflections included in the refinement | 0.1605 |
Goodness-of-fit parameter for all reflections included in the refinement | 1.057 |
Diffraction radiation wavelength | 0.71073 Å |
Diffraction radiation type | MoKα |
Has coordinates | Yes |
Has disorder | No |
Has Fobs | No |
